Easy to maintain

French Bulldogs, or "Frenchies," as they're affectionately known are now among the most sought-after breeds of dogs in recent years. Their adorable looks and jolly disposition make them the perfect companions for any age. But, just like any other breed they require special care to be healthy and happy. Regular exercise is necessary to keep the muscles of these dogs strong. They also require routine grooming and dental treatment. These pups are easy-going and love being the center of attraction.

They are ideal apartment pets because they don't need lots of space and don't need to spend time on the couch. They generally have a great relationship with children and other pets, but should be carefully introduced to children to avoid accidental injuries. In addition, they might not tolerate rough play, especially from larger, more boisterous dogs. Their brachycephalic form means they are not good swimmers and should be kept in a kennel close to water bodies.

Also, they must be aware of their skin folds. If they are not kept clean, a condition known as skin fold dermatitis can be created. You can avoid this by cleaning your neck and face with an aqueous cloth or medicated wipes frequently. Also, give them baths every couple of months and use a mild shampoo to ensure their skin is healthy.

Frenchies also require regular dental care and nail trimming. Cleaning their teeth regularly and visiting the vet when needed can help prevent gum disease. They are also more susceptible to ear infections than other breeds. Therefore, it's essential to keep them clean and look for signs of ear issues often.

Frenchies can also gain weight quickly. It is important to keep an an eye on their diet and take them on short walks to avoid overexertion. Also, keep them away from hot weather because they are prone to overheating. If you spot any signs of excessive heat in your French Bulldog, contact your vet immediately.

Low-maintenance

French Bulldogs require minimal exercise and grooming. They are able to live in a home and French Bulldog love being petted by their owners. These dogs are playful and can entertain and delight their owners by playing with them. They are happy to relax and sit. They don't bark a lot and rarely show aggression.

They are extremely social and are able to get along with other dogs, cats and even children. While they might be reserved with strangers, Frenchies are usually friendly and welcoming towards guests. They can be housed with other pets in the house however they are not an ideal choice for a home with small animals due to their size and their strong instincts to guard their food and possessions. They also don't take extreme heat and must be kept indoors during hot weather.

Frenchies like other short-faced dogs, can be afflicted with back problems like intervertebral disk diseases. To avoid this avoid over-training them or leaving them outside for prolonged periods of time. Also, they are not great swimmers and should be kept out of the ponds and pools. They can also develop a condition called entropion, in which their eyes move inwards which can cause cornea irritation. This is a hereditary condition that can lead to blindness, but it is able to be corrected through surgery.
